I’ve recently been reading Faith & Work: Do They Mix? by Os Hillman. Excellent book and it was whilst reading it, I got the idea for this blog - and was pleasantly surprised that this domain was waiting for me to purchase. I will be sharing what I’ve been learning through reading and research in the hope that it will also provide answers to your searches and prayers.
